#3dd51d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3dd51d is composed of 23.9% red, 83.5%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.4%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 109.6 degrees, a saturation of 76% and a lightness of 47.5%. #3dd51d color hex could be obtained by blending #7aff3a with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#3dd51d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3dd51d has RGB values of R:61, G:213,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 4052253.
